NettetThe 'Ling sounds' are a range of speech sounds encompassing the speech frequencies that are widely used clinically to verify the effectiveness of hearing aid fitting in children. The Ling sound test was originally developed for the North American population. NettetLing Sounds. The Ling Six Sound Test (Ling 1976) consists of six speech sounds. 3 vowels (oo,ee,ah) and 3 consonants (m,s,sh). These sounds cover the normal speech frequency range (250-8000 Hz) and can be used to show if low, mid and high frequency speech sounds can be heard.
